Vitold was born in Lublin, Poland. During a nine years period from 1995
he attended music school, where he was taught to play two instruments:
the violin and the piano. When he left the school in 2004, he joined
the local theatre group 'Panopticum'. After the first contact with an
acting field, he felt an urge to follow that path and decided to apply
to an university. Firstly, he studied Culture Animator and Manager with
Theatre specialization at the Maria Curie Sklodowska University in
Lublin. During the classes he had plenty of possibilities to develop my
skills in acting and directing. In 2007, after performing in numerous
plays - e.g. 'Inaczej' (2009) directed by Dorota Zaniuk and 'Listy do
Olgi' (2010) directed by Dominika Piwowarczyk - he graduated with the
Bechelor's degree with his own play 'Widmokrag' based on a novel by
Wojeciech Kuczok. In 2010 he performed in an advertisement for the
ElectricNights Festival and then, in 2011, he played a leading role in
the short movie Stranger directed by Karol M. Kowalski, which was shown
at a few independent movie festivals across Poland. In 2012 he moved to
Cracow, where he enrolled for Drama in the Cracow Schools of Art and
Fashion Design. Starting in November 2013, they have played 'Umarli ze
Spoon River' based on Edgar Lee Masters' 'Spoon River Anthology' and
directed by Jan Korwin Kochanowski. Next year he will finish the polish
acting school and he is going to move to London to deepen his skills in
the Meisner technique.
